How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Perkins?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Perkins Studio Apartments | $1,136 | $675 | $1,589 |
| Perkins 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,228 | $569 | $2,187 |
| Perkins 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,389 | $675 | $2,718 |
| Perkins 3 Bedroom Apartments | $2,409 | $555 | $3,493 |
| Perkins 4 Bedroom Apartments | $1,794 | $455 | $3,600 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Perkins
How much are Studio apartments in Perkins?
There are currently 6 Studio Apartments in Perkins with rent ranges from $675 to $1,589 with an average price of $1,136.
What is the current price range for One Bedroom Perkins Apartments for rent?
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Perkins ranges from $569 to $2,187 with an average monthly rent of $1,228.
What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Perkins c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Perkins range from $675 to $2,718.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$1,389.
How expensive are Perkins Three Bedroom Apartments?
There are currently 21 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Perkins on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$555 to $3,493 - averaging $2,409 for the location.
